Type
ORACLE
Validation date
2025-05-16 10: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 1.787e-4,
    "usd": 0.0002
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FD7EF96C505C37DBD4A50BD2FA855C040675B56348E23D5B748B76EC60E62ABB

Previous signature

56E33C8EBCB304586469CC1151B62127F752302A81E5197940CB15F0C7799799293897E288E6CDF312C79BF0B5A53B8218DDB3A36421BAC8233F6F49BCE4C702

Origin signature

304402205935C8414BDEF89F0D18E3B010186E0ACDC1E20F5CE3C3978E1C0AB0B8D9A93D02204E164F6729A58D4CF5C317FD7A54D0BF296D5BC0AEE824CB33B3967F3865E90F

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00ACDCC7FED46E40CCEA05D163655B2B577150E5605DB1F06900715A211A22504E

Coordinator signature

E32B5D570DC2CC976D6686913F464B2CCD5890FB441806E77E3D98495F16B029457E6AD3AAC3ABA5AB3FD8954073C43E5BDB0EFC0460D27D55FEC61B5ADDA00F

Validator #1 public key

0001959E3582B8A0A55C8B199B564D5B10C740A45E5EF6B782032C790C3AAF0BCC3E

Validator #1 signature

464AD0B2D85135244D92B15F46AD48991EBEB7836BF69CFC17A1A315F931F34CB509E8C595FDE833ACE8D87D5E73182A7742290AEDC7A2C776F76B78C6B6D50E

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

96F7A83DD5AF0A0BBF7DAF0C55F8442B9421515F64F82D73CAD5D930537258E24849308BDE4BF74235ABB12ECE4F31CD29C0B0A806EAA6BF9102C5F55488F602